2 cups flour

1 tsp baking soda

2 cups sugar

  • 2 e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 20 oz. crushed pineapple
  • Topping:
  • ½ cup butter
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 cup pecans
  • 1 cup shredded coconut

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ray a 9×13 pan with nonstick spray. Stir cake ingredients well. Pour in to pan. Bake for 30-40 minutes. Remove from oven and poke holes in the top with a skewer. 

Combine butter, vanilla, and sugar in a small saucepan. Cook on medium high heat until thickened, 3-5 minutes. 

Remove mixture from heat and stir in pecans and coconut. Immediately pour over cake and let sink in. Broil for a minute or two to caramelize coconut. Let cool and serve.
